What is a 2nd Unit 2nd AD?

Overview
A 2nd Unit 2nd AD is a crucial role within the production department of a film crew. They are responsible for assisting the 2nd Assistant Director specifically on the second unit of a production.
Role & Responsibilities
The role of a 2nd Unit 2nd AD involves supporting the 2nd AD on the second unit, which typically handles shots that do not require the principal cast. They help coordinate the logistics of the second unit shoot, ensuring that everything runs smoothly and efficiently. This role requires strong organizational skills and the ability to work well under pressure.
Skills Required
A 2nd Unit 2nd AD must possess excellent communication and problem-solving skills. They should be detail-oriented and able to multitask effectively. Strong leadership abilities are also crucial, as they often need to oversee a team of production assistants on set. Additionally, knowledge of production procedures and familiarity with industry software tools are valuable skills for this role.
Education
While a formal college degree may not be a requirement for a 2nd Unit 2nd AD, relevant experience in the film industry is essential. This position often requires previous work as a production assistant or in a similar role to gain the necessary skills and knowledge.
